Output 3d65525c256e05a2c016bd4dd5c3ddd663bf417085849521a51d378895012041:1

value
95675469
script pubkey
OP_0 OP_PUSHBYTES_20 08675832d1c55d9af771da519763ac3b3def1a7a
address
bc1qppn4svk3c4we4am3mfgewcav8v777xn665f3hj
transaction
3d65525c256e05a2c016bd4dd5c3ddd663bf417085849521a51d378895012041
spent
true